Rosetta Stone shares surge on 4Q report ARLINGTON, Va. — Shares of Rosetta Stone Inc. surged in late trading Thursday after the maker of language-learning software reported its fourth-quarter profit more than doubled on strong demand from consumers and institutional customers. Rosetta Stone's profit and revenue both topped Wall Street expectations, although the company issued profit forecasts ... Read more »»».
